Formula

To calculate the volume when the dimensions are provided in inches, use this formula:

Volume (cubic inches) = Length × Width × Height

To convert cubic inches to cubic feet:

Volume (cubic feet) = Volume (cubic inches) ÷ 1728

Why 1728? Because there are 12 inches in a foot, and:
12 × 12 × 12 = 1728 cubic inches in 1 cubic foot

Example

Example 1:

  • Length = 12 inches
  • Width = 10 inches
  • Height = 6 inches

Step 1: Multiply all three:
12 × 10 × 6 = 720 cubic inches

Step 2: Convert to cubic feet:
720 ÷ 1728 = 0.4167 cubic feet

So, the volume is 720 in³ or 0.42 ft³
